網頁上傳好煩人阿
我想問大家有沒有人知道.為什麼網頁在frontpage中超連結過後.預覽檔案出ㄉ來.而上傳網站後卻ㄧ直都出不來ㄋ?但是所有檔案我都傳ㄌ呀!
4 個解答
評分
- 匿名使用者2 0 年前最佳解答
你的圖片路徑是設為相對路徑還是絕對路徑??
1.相對路徑
ex: /images/01.gif
會隨著文件的位置去找上一層目錄中,images資料夾中 01.gif 的檔案秀出
此種方法在修改方面會比較方便
但有時電腦的路徑會變成這種--> E:/Web/images/01.gif
就是最前面設定在電腦本身的磁碟槽
這時丟上 ftp ,就會產生讀不到(顯示不出)的問題囉
只要把 "E:/Web"這些字去掉,就可以了
小心,留下的是 "/images/..." ,而不是"images/..."
如果前面有 "/" 代表是在上一層目錄
如同沒有,則是在同一層目錄的 images 資料夾中的 0.1gif 檔
2.絕對路徑
ex: http://www.***.com.tw/images/01.gif
這時伺服器會從網路上自動去抓檔案
除非是路徑錯誤,或是資料已不存在,否則出現問題的機會不大
但這種方式的缺點在於修改網頁很費時
因為你要一個一個超連結慢慢的去 key
........希望我寫的不會太複雜...
- 匿名使用者2 0 年前
電腦太爛了吧..跑太慢..我猜的
- ✖ ▽ ✖Lv 42 0 年前
除了以上兩位說的檔案存放問題外,還有一個可能,就是檔名不一樣。
在win系統中,大小寫不一樣還是會視同一樣的檔案,但上傳至網路後的系統(好像是lxxxx…不知怎麼打)只要大小寫不一樣就會視為不同~
像我之前有過:a01.jpg、A01.jpg、a01.Jpg…都會視為不同檔!
- 匿名使用者2 0 年前
那會不會是檔案或圖片沒放在同一個資料呢??....
還有問題?馬上發問,尋求解答。